Mission
To train postgraduate students to be high-quality toxicologists by providing up-to-date knowledge and rigorous scientific training in toxicology, with a particular emphasis on utilizing toxicological data to solve toxicology-related health and environmental challenges, in addition to conducting high-quality toxicological research.
Objectives
- To provide the health, environmental and regulatory sectors with highly qualified toxicologists to enhance public health and safety.
- To graduate highly skilled researchers in the field of toxicology.
- To explain the basic principles of toxicology and their application to human health and the environment.
- To understand how molecular mechanisms, biological processes, and chemical reactivity influence possible toxicant targets at the molecular, organ, and physiological levels.
- To understand basic techniques and methodologies in toxicology and the use of laboratory instrumentation.
- To demonstrate the ability to analyze, interpret, and critique relevant research articles in toxicology.
- To demonstrate oral and written presentation skills by communicating findings of original toxicological data to various healthcare professionals and the public.
